CLEVELAND — Dermatologists are best positioned to use a combination of interventions to treat hidradenitis suppurativa, including medications and surgery, according to a speaker at Cleveland Clinic’s Medical Dermatology Therapy Update IV. “Combination therapy is the rule for hidradenitis suppurativa,” Steven Daveluy, MD, a dermatologist at Wayne State University, told
